PRINCETON, N.J. – Rutgers men's track and field collected three event titles and set numerous PRs at the Sam Howell Invitational hosted by Princeton on Saturday.
Â
Senior
Sterling Pierce (200m), sophomore
Eric Barnes (800m) and senior
John Mooers (Discus Throw) each collected tiles in their respective events. Overall, the Scarlet Knights recorded seven Top 3 finishes at the meet.

TRACK EVENTS
Pierce won the 200m with a time of 21.46, as sophomore
Semaj Willis followed in the event with a result of 22.57.
Â
Barnes claimed the 800m title in the unseeded event with a personal record of 1:53.44. Senior
Edward Zaleck finished fourth in the event with a time of 1:56.08, while freshman
Chris Smith finished eighth with a PR of 1:56.73. Senior
Dimitri Demos added a time of 1:57.96 in the event.
Sophomore
Christopher Jenkins finished third in the 400m hurdles with a time of 53.26.
The 4x400m relay team of Pierce, Jenkins, Willis and freshman
Jameson Woodell were runner-ups in the event with a time of 3:14.98.
 Â
Pierce also finished third in the 100m, clocking a time of 10.80. Freshman
A'Nan Bridgett followed with a time of 11.15.
 Â
Freshman
Andrew Daniluk clocked a time of 15.35 in the 110m hurdles, finishing ninth in the field.
Â
FIELD EVENTS
Mooers won the discus throw title with a personal-best 54.35m (178' 11") throw. Sophomore
Jason Campbell finished in second with a throw of 52.34m (171' 8"). Freshman
Kamron Kobolak added a 43.45m (142' 6") throw in the event, while also recording a throw of 15.25m (50' 0.5") in the shot put to finish fifth.
Â
In the high jump, senior
Jordan Lorenzo finished seventh with a jump of 1.98m (6' 6") followed by Bridgett with a mark of 1.93m (6' 4"). Junior
Patrick Warren posted a mark of 6.49m (21' 3.5") in the long jump.
